What is an enzymatic cleaner?

An enzymatic cleaner is a type of cleaning agent that contains enzymes that break down organic matter. These cleaners are typically used to clean carpets and upholstery, but can also be used to clean and deodorize fabrics, bathrooms, and kitchens.

They can be found in liquid, powder, or spray form. Enzymatic cleaners typically come in either fruit or floral scents or unscented varieties.

Enzymes in the cleaner are designed to attack and break down organic matter, such as proteins and oils, which can be found in pet and human urine, vomit, and other bodily fluids. The enzymes interact with the proteins and oils and break them down into smaller molecules, which are not visible to the naked eye.

As a result, enzymatic cleaners have been found to be very effective in removing odors, stains, and bacteria.

Enzymatic cleaners are often preferred over traditional cleaners because they are more gentle on surfaces and fabrics and don’t contain potentially harmful chemicals. Furthermore, they do not leave behind a strong chemical scent like many other types of cleaners.

However, it is important to be aware that enzymatic cleaners are not a “one-size-fits-all” solution, and need to be appropriately matched to the material being cleaned.

Is Dawn dish soap an enzyme cleaner?

No, Dawn dish soap is not an enzyme cleaner. Dawn dish soap is a surfactant-based soap that helps remove grease and oils from surfaces. While it helps to remove dirt, it does not contain enzymes like other cleaners.

Enzyme cleaners, such as found in some detergents and carpet cleaners, break down complicated proteins and other components into smaller molecules to help remove soil. However, Dawn dish soap does not contain these enzymes and is not designed to break down soils in the same way enzyme cleaners do.

How long does it take for enzyme cleaner to work?

Enzyme cleaner typically takes from 10 minutes to several hours to work, depending on the type of cleaner and the severity of the stain or mess. Generally, for normal spills and messes, enzyme cleaner will work within 10 minutes to an hour.

For more serious messes and stains, such as pet stains, it may take several hours or even up to 24 hours for the cleaner to be effectively removed. If you need a more detailed answer on how long it will take the enzyme cleaner to take effect, the best option would be to consult the instructions on the specific cleaner that you are using.
